Ecclesbourne Road is in Thornton Heath and in Croydon district. CR7 7BQ is located in the Bensham Manor electoral ward, within the English Parliamentary constituency of Croydon North. This postcode has been in use since 1990-07-01.

People

Gender

In the UK, the overall gender distribution is approximately 49% male and 51% female. However, the area surrounding CR7 7BQ, has a female population slightly higher than UK average, with 53.7% of residents being female. Several factors can contribute to this. Women generally live longer than men, resulting in a higher proportion of women in neighborhoods with significant elderly populations. Typically, as people grow older, they tend to relocate from city center addresses to suburban areas, smaller towns, and rural locations. Consequently, these areas often have a higher number of females. A higher female population can also be found in areas with industries that employ more women, such as healthcare, education, and retail.

Partnership Status

Across the UK, the average relationship status breakdown is roughly 44% married, 38% single, 9% divorced, 6% widowed, and 2% separated.

In the immediate area around CR7 7BQ, a significant portion of the population is single, making up 49.8% of the residents. On average, approximately 38% of individuals who responded to the census in the UK were single. Areas with higher single populations are typically urban centers, university towns, regions with dynamic job markets, rich cultural offerings and entertainment facilities. These regions also tend to have a younger demographic.

Safety

Is Ecclesbourne Road dangerous?

Over the last 12 months, the overall crime rate around Ecclesbourne Road was 98.6 per 1,000 residents, which is 7.5% higher than the Bensham Manor average. The most reported crime type was Anti-social behaviour.

Ecclesbourne Road has the 49th lowest crime rate of 100 local areas in Bensham Manor and the 401st highest crime rate of 1,082 local areas in Croydon .

Violent and sexual offences accounted for around 34.0 crimes per 1,000 residents and have been rising year on year. Over the last decade, overall crime has fallen by about -19.6%.
